What the public plan does not cover
RAMQ covers medical care, not lost income nor most of the costs that accompany a serious illness: travel, home help, adapting a home, uncovered medication, a relative who stops working to provide care. That gap is what this coverage targets.
Critical illness: a lump sum
Critical illness insurance pays a single amount on diagnosis of an illness covered by the contract, after a survival period. The money is tied to no expense: you use it as you choose. The list of covered illnesses and their definitions vary by contract, and that is the heart of the product.
Definitions matter more than the list
Two contracts can both “cover cancer” and pay in different situations, depending on the stage and the wording used. Reading an illness’s definition, not just its name on the list, is the only honest way to compare.
Survival period and waiting period
Most contracts require surviving a set number of days after diagnosis for the benefit to be paid. Some also provide an initial period during which specific conditions are not covered. Both appear in the contract.
Supplementary health care
Health coverage — medication, dental, paramedical — answers a different need: frequent, predictable expenses rather than a single financial shock. It compares on annual ceilings, co-insurance, and exclusions, not on the premium alone.
Without a group plan
Self-employed, contract worker, business owner: without an employer plan, this coverage is taken out individually, and eligibility is assessed at subscription. The earlier the request, the wider the options.
Pre-existing conditions
A condition known at subscription may be excluded, priced differently, or lead to a refusal, depending on the insurer and the condition. Transparency at subscription protects the benefit: an omission can void it.

How does this differ from disability insurance?
Critical illness insurance pays a single amount on diagnosis. Disability insurance replaces income during an incapacity. They answer two different needs and are often combined.
